Living at 6000 feet in New Mexico, whenever it gets cold we head to Roosevelt Lake north of Globe and East of the Phoenix Metro. The sonoran desert is beautiful, the biking and hiking is great and it is little used until March. For the rest of this year you can stay using the "Tonto Pass" available locally at $6 per night ($3 if your an "old guy"). Starting in 2016 the rates go up to $16 (or $8) per night. Still a good deal, all sites are "no hookup" but solar heated showers are included. We will be there next week, probably at Windy Hill, Coati Loop. Look us up!
